| Midway Geyser Basin: Grand Prismatic Spring, Yellow Stone National Park
The fiery plain in this photo, a burning orange color given to it by the bacteria and algae that live in it, is cut off in the horizon of the landscape by a hill covered in a gloomy forest of charred trees. Yellowstone National Park, Wyoming, although an exciting place to visit (especially for nature photography!), isn’t exactly fatality free. Dead trees, like the ones in this photograph, are common enough, but there are also pools of water with whole skeletons of animals that fell in unfortunately and were consumed by the boiling waters.
